The Growing Global Interest in Peptides

Interest in peptides has expanded rapidly in recent years due to their potential roles in signaling, tissue repair, and metabolic regulation. These short chains of amino acids act as biological messengers, influencing a wide range of processes in the human body. Researchers are particularly interested in how peptides may support recovery and cellular communication, which has led to increased discussion in both scientific and wellness communities. While the topic is often surrounded by hype, credible studies continue to investigate their real mechanisms and limitations. Scientific Foundations and Ongoing Research

Understanding peptides requires a closer look at biochemistry and molecular signaling. Peptides function by binding to receptors on cells, triggering specific biological responses that can affect growth, immune activity, or hormonal regulation. However, it is important to distinguish between experimental findings and clinical applications, as not all peptide-related claims are supported by large-scale human studies. According to the U.S. National Institutes of Health (NIH), peptide-based therapies are still an evolving area of biomedical research, with ongoing trials exploring safety, effectiveness, and delivery methods.
